Flies expressing Adck1NIG.3608R under the control of either Scer\GAL4Tub.PU (in combination with a Gal80[ts] transgene to restrict expression to the adult stage) or Scer\GAL4Mhc.PU (but not Scer\GAL4Cg.PU or Scer\GAL4nSyb.PU) show defective "held-up" wing position phenotypes, reduced locomotor activity and slower walking speed than controls.
In flies expressing Adck1NIG.3608R under the control of either Scer\GAL4Tub.PU (in combination with a Gal80[ts] transgene to restrict expression to the adult stage) or Scer\GAL4Mhc.PU, thoracic muscles are abnormally oriented and show deformed mitochondrial morphologies. Additionally, expression under the control of Scer\GAL4Tub.PU induces cell death in thoracic muscles.
Expressing Adck1NIG.3608R under the control of Scer\GAL4Sgs3.PD results in mitochondria with a larger area than controls in salivary glands of third instar larvae.
Scer\GAL4Ilp2.PR-mediated expression results in a significant reduction in the body weight of emerging adults compared to controls.
